Вопросы к Поиску с Алисой

Примеры ответов Поиска с Алисой
Главная / Наука и образование / В чем разница между cardinality и distinct при подсчете уникальных значений в базе данных?
Вопрос для Поиска с Алисой
15 сентября

В чем разница между cardinality и distinct при подсчете уникальных значений в базе данных?

Алиса
На основе источников, возможны неточности

Возможно, имелись в виду понятия «кардиналити» и «distinct» в контексте баз данных.

Cardinality — это количество уникальных значений в столбце таблицы. readstic.com Оно может быть низким, если в столбце всего несколько уникальных значений (например, gender с male и female), и высоким, если большинство значений в колонке уникальны (например, user_id в таблице пользователей). readstic.com

Distinct — ключевое слово, которое используется для удаления дубликатов из результирующего набора данных. habr.com Однако использование Distinct увеличивает время выполнения запроса, поскольку база данных должна выполнить дополнительные операции для удаления дубликатов. habr.com

Таким образом, разница между cardinality и distinct в том, что первое понятие описывает количество уникальных значений в столбце, а второе — процесс удаления дубликатов.

Примеры полезных ответов Поиска с Алисой на вопросы из разных сфер. Вопросы сгенерированы нейросетью YandexGPT для актуальных тем, которые определяются на базе обобщённых запросов к Поиску с Алисой.
Задать новый вопрос
Задайте вопрос...
…и сразу получите ответ в Поиске с Алисой
Войдите, чтобы поставить лайк
С Яндекс ID это займёт пару секунд
Войти
Tue Aug 26 2025 09:00:20 GMT+0300 (Moscow Standard Time)